Indiana University - South Bend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Indiana University - South Bend was $664 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$236 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In State Out of State
Tuition $7,067 $19,926
Fees $648 $648
Books and Supplies $930 $930
On Campus Room and Board $8,958 $8,958
On Campus Other Expenses $2,642 $2,642

Indiana University - South Bend Liberal Arts BA Student Debt

One way to think about how much a school will cost is to look at how much in student loans that you have to take out to get your degree. Liberal Arts students who received their bachelor’s degree at Indiana University - South Bend took out an average of $26,000 in student loans. That is 10% higher than the national average of $23,628.

Indiana University - South Bend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Liberal Arts

84 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
73.8% Women
21.4%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 84 bachelor’s degrees in liberal arts aw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 73.8% of the students who received their BA in liberal arts in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 64.7%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 21.4% of the liberal arts bachelor’s degrees at Indiana University - South Bend in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 38%.
